Episode 7. Have you ever found yourself suddenly having to teach a class you know nothing about? It happens far too often. This is what led me to this topic today. Listen in as I talk about a framework for teaching Fashion Marketing that engages your students and introduces them to marketing concepts, while providing rigorous activities and projects that immerse them into the fashion industry. RESOURCEThe Ultimate Fashion Marketing Class Bundle is packed with 4 vibrant presentations, fun and engaging activities, quizzes, and 4 major projects for an immersive semester of fashion exploration.
